2010-10-26 2 views
1

Je me demandais s'il existe un moyen simple de styliser un ListView avec ses éléments comme la conversation dans l'application de messagerie texte d'android. Il y a des coins arrondis et des trucs comme ça, où je ne suis pas sûr de savoir comment je pourrais le faire moi-même.Android: style ListView comme les conversations de messages texte

Je sais que je pourrais chercher le code source de celui-ci, et essayer de copier à partir de là, mais c'est une application énorme avec beaucoup de fichiers et c'est pourquoi j'ai décidé de demander d'abord.

Merci à l'avance, Jan Oliver

Répondre

1

Voici un bon endroit pour commencer https://dl.google.com/googleio/2010/android-world-of-listview-android.pdf vous allez vouloir essentiellement utiliser un adaptateur pour gonfler les vues que vous faites dans l'éditeur XML. Une fois que vous avez des questions plus spécifiques, nous pouvons entrer dans plus de détails.

+0

Merci pour le lien! Je vais le regarder et voir si cela résout mon problème. – janoliver

+0

Le lien est cassé. D: –

1

Je ne vois pas de coins arrondis dans l'application SMS stock ...? De toute façon, les coins arrondis sont assez faciles à faire avec 9-patch png files. Autre que cela le style de l'application SMS est assez simple. Il contient un couple de TextViews, et un QuickContactBadge, quelques couleurs de fond différentes, et c'est tout.

+0

Merci, c'est probablement ce que je cherchais. Dans l'application SMS, entre les messages de dates différentes, il y a un diviseur noir (en fait, il a un dégradé en arrière-plan) et les messages blancs ont des coins arrondis. – janoliver